Outline of Final Research Achievements |
This research investigates the effects of man-made disaster on the dynamics of productivity and the vulnerability of farm households in prewar Japan. We especially focus on the Great Depression, as a representative example of man-made disaster. Our main findings are as follows. First, although the Malmquist productivity index decreased rapidly after the Great Depression occurred, due to the technical and efficiency change, this rapid productivity decrease was temporary. Second, the vulnerability of farm households to the Great Depression differed across regions, and large-scale farmers were relatively robust to the Great Depression.
